Major Saline County Real Estate Markets

Harrisburg dominates as the primary real estate hub, offering the most diverse property types from historic downtown buildings to newer residential developments. The city benefits from being a regional healthcare and government center, creating steady demand for both commercial and residential properties. Eldorado and Carrier Mills serve as secondary markets, each with distinct characteristics—Eldorado focusing more on family homes and small farms, while Carrier Mills attracts buyers interested in affordable starter homes and investment properties.

The county's smaller communities like Galatia, Muddy, and Stonefort operate as micro-markets where personal relationships often drive transactions more than traditional marketing approaches. These areas see significant interest from buyers seeking rural retreats, hunting properties, or agricultural investments. The proximity to recreational areas creates seasonal fluctuations in market activity, with spring and summer months typically showing increased interest in rural and recreational properties.

Market Dynamics and Geographic Complexity

Saline County's real estate market exhibits surprising resilience due to its diverse economic base, including agriculture, small manufacturing, and tourism related to outdoor recreation. Property values remain relatively stable, with less volatility than urban markets, making it attractive for investors seeking steady returns. The market benefits from its position along major highways, providing accessibility while maintaining rural character that appeals to buyers seeking affordable alternatives to urban living.

Geographic factors play a crucial role in property desirability, with parcels closer to the Shawnee National Forest commanding premium prices despite the overall affordable market conditions. Coal mining history has created both challenges and opportunities, with some former mining areas now repurposed for development while others offer unique recreational possibilities. The county's topography, featuring rolling hills and wooded areas, creates distinct micro-markets where elevation, timber coverage, and water access significantly influence property values.
